An ideal gas heat engine operates in Carnot cycle between `227^@C` and `127^@C`. It absorbs `6.0 xx 10^4 cal` of heat at high temperature. Amount of heat converted to work is :

A

`2.4xx10^(4) cal`

B

`4.8xx10^(4) cal`

C

`1.2xx10^(4) cal`

D

`6.0xx10^(4) cal`

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
C

`eta = (T_(2)-T_(1))/(T_(2))=(500-400)/500=1/5`
`:. W=etaxxQ=1/5xx6.0xx10^(4)=1.2xx10^(4)cal`
